About the Item

Tapestry by Pinton Freres and Alexander Calder Woven wool Titled "Serpent au Vitrail N0 20" Woven signature, Pinton Freres tapestry mark Numbered 3/6 on the reverse, With the label of publisher: Art Vivant Inc, New Rochelle, New York, Label (Bolduc) of the producer Pinton Frères, Aubusson, France, on the reverse, New museum frame Exceptional condition Tapestry alone measures 77"H x 53.5"W Available to view in-situ in our Miami gallery
